Mopar Pro Street 4130 Housing Ends for 3.150" Bearing.This ends use a Timken® unit bearing (p/n 58506) and a heavy duty outside seal for Pro Street applications. This end has provision for a inboard seal in the event of bearing leakage. If using a OEM brake backing plate the center hole must be enlarged to 3.150" so the backing plate will go over the larger bearing.

Mark Williams housing ends provide an excellent way to narrow a rear end housing. They also allow increased axle strength by utilizing a larger wheel bearing compared to factory. The ends have a prevision for an inboard seal in the event of bearing leakage.
Mark Williams housing ends are different than the competition. We start with a heat treated 4130 forging for a stronger component. Most modern race rear ends are built using 4130 chromoly tubing for the housing, so keeping that strenght with the housing end is crucial. Simply put 4130 is chosen for its higher overall strength, toughness, and ductility so why risk using mild steel or 8620 in this high load situation?
Our ends are slightly longer than the other on the market, allowing for an inboard seal in case you have a leaky wheel bearing. Being further out the weld distortion doesn’t have an effect on the diameter for the bearing. Mark Williams housing ends are bored with a very slight taper that allows the housing end to distort slightly, but not get tight on the bearing. The difference is real!
